SEC. 2. Section 103 of the National Traffic and Motor 22 Vehicle Safety Act of 1966 (15 U.S.C. 1392) is amended 23 by adding at the end of such section the following new sub24 section:

25

"(i) (1) The Secretary shall establish, within six

1 months after the date of enactment of this subsection, appro2 priate Federal motor vehicle safety standards for schoolbuses, 3 including, but not limited to, standards relating to the fol4 lowing aspects of performance:

"(A) seat design, including standards for padding, height, and mounting of seats to insure adequate pro

tection of occupants;

"(B) crashworthiness of body and frame, including standards for fastening devices and side padding to insure greater protection of occupants in the event of crash;

"(C) operating systems, including standards to insure safe braking, electrical, and exhaust systems;

"(D) flammability of materials, including standards providing for the use of fire-resistant materials in the composition of the schoolbus to insure safety of occupants in the event of fire;

“(E) floor strength, including standards for secure and strong floors to prevent exposure of sharp edges in the event of orash;

"(F) driver protection, including standards for seatbelt arrangements for busdriver;

"((i) emergency exits, including standards for out opening emergency exits.

"(2) Such standards shall become effective with respect

1 to schoolbuses manufactured more than eighteen months

2 after the date of enactment of this subsection.
